Open 24 Hours
Saturday
Like
4 Views
Address : Glen Rd, London, Newham, Greater London, E13 8SL, United Kingdom (UK)
Constituent Country :England
Phone No. :442074764000
Email :RLHpals.bartshealth@nhs.net
Official website : https://www.bartshealth.nhs.uk/newham
Share this Business with others:
Send Enquiry